Art Exhibition Policy

By providing space in which to exhibit original works of Northfield area artists the Dickinson Memorial Library Trustees hope to:

Acquaint library patrons with the talents of Northfield area artists

Promote the work of Northfield area artists

Encourage self-education through art appreciation

The exhibition of art at Dickinson Memorial Library is by invitation. While artists are encouraged to seek an invitation, the final decision will be at the discretion of the Librarian and the Trustees reserve the right to review works for their appropriateness and to reject any work that seems inappropriate. Northfield residents will always have priority in scheduling art exhibits

Length of Exhibit

Exhibits will be two months unless other arrangements are requested. All works should remain until the last exhibit day.

Setting Up

The artist will oversee placement and dismantling of the exhibit.

Description and Price Sheet

The artist should leave a list describing each piece. Person interested in purchasing a particular work should contact the artist directly.

Liability

The artist in encouraged to carry insurance on valuable works as the Trustees cannot be liable for theft or loss. All artists will be required to sign a liability waiver

Publicity

The artist is responsible for publicizing the exhibit. When there is a special and/or shared event publicity will be arranged between the artist and the Librarian
